Revert "Test using unified upload pages"

This reverts commit 3668d9f672.
This commit is contained in:
TiejunZhou
2023-11-24 03:00:28 +00:00
parent 91eab7486f
commit f28222d87b

View File

@@ -128,10 +128,18 @@ jobs:
${{ inputs.cmake_path }}/coverage_report/${{ inputs.result_affix }}
fi
- name: Upload Code Coverage Artifacts
uses: actions/upload-artifact@v3.1.3
if: ${{ inputs.skip_deploy }}
with:
name: github-pages
path: ${{ inputs.cmake_path }}/coverage_report
- name: Upload Code Coverage Pages
uses: actions/upload-pages-artifact@v2.0.0
if: ${{ !inputs.skip_deploy }}
with:
path: ${{ inputs.cmake_path }}/coverage_report/
path: ${{ inputs.cmake_path }}/coverage_report/default_build_coverage
deploy_code_coverage:
runs-on: ubuntu-latest
@@ -145,6 +153,16 @@ jobs:
id-token: write
steps:
- uses: actions/download-artifact@v3
with:
name: github-pages
- name: Upload Code Coverage Pages
uses: actions/upload-pages-artifact@v2.0.0
if: inputs.skip_test
with:
path: .
- name: Deploy GitHub Pages site
id: deployment
uses: actions/deploy-pages@v1.2.9